    I got a question. IF you develop this software for the iPhone/Droid, would it work the same for devices running Windows Mobile?

    I probably won't bother writing anything for it. The software I mentioned in the OP has already been written and only needs to be installed by the site admin and his goons. Once it gets installed on the back end, the dedicated app that works with it is available for iPhone, Android, BlackBerry, and Nokia phones. People who use a browser instead, which could include the actual web browsers on iPhone, Android, BB, and Nokia as well as Windows Mobile or even a laptop or desktop, would not see any difference.
